Community Movement Practice

Feeling disconnected from your body or curious about movement without the pressure of a traditional dance class?

This flow is all about moving freely, listening to your body, and finding your own rhythm. With Marina, we’ll explore non-goal-directed movement in a low-pressure, supportive environment—no choreography or dance technique required. Rooted in the idea that humans have long used collective movement to build connection, Community Movement offers a gentle reentry point into creative expression.

We’ll focus on proprioception, discovering what movements feel good in your unique body, and strengthening your creative instincts in an approachable way. This class is for anyone new to or returning to movement, with the belief that everyone is a dancer—the key is learning the language of movement.

No experience needed — just come as you are. Whether you’re new or returning after a break, this space invites joy, expression, and connection through movement.
